DOJ announces pattern and practice investigation into MPD
Assistant Attorney General Kristen Clarke of the Civil Rights Division announced that the Department of Justice is opening an investigation into the City of Memphis and Memphis Police Department on Thursday, July 27, 2023 in Memphis. (Mark Weber/The Daily Memphian)
Department of Justice Assistant Attorney General Kristen Clarke of the Civil Rights Division said that the investigation is not tied to one specific incident or unit of MPD.
